Title :
Effects of system parameters on the performance characteristics of a wind turbine generating system using a current-source thyristor inverter

Abstract :
The effects of various system parameters on the performance characteristics of a wind turbine generating system using a current-source thyristor inverter are investigated. The configuration of the system and a simulation model for predicting the dynamic performances of the system are first explained. Then the effects of various parameters of the system, such as short-circuit ratio of synchronous compensator, on the steady-state characteristics and the dynamic performances of the system are discussed.
